Brain-Based Psychological Health Counseling for Dependency Healing

New approaches to addiction healing are increasingly integrating the principles of neuroscience – a field now known as neuro-focused mental health intervention. This modern approach moves beyond traditional counseling techniques, recognizing that addiction fundamentally alters neurological function. Approaches might utilize neurofeedback to help clients regulate cerebral functioning, or cognitive training exercises designed to enhance executive skills impaired by drug abuse. Ultimately, neurological therapy aims to restore cerebral health, thereby minimizing urges and promoting long-term abstinence.
